Comics, to me, were always a mystery. I was a card collector when I was a kid, somewhere in my hoard of cards I have a rookie Wayne Gretzky (in poor shape, cuz I was a damn kid!). Mainly, I collected football cards. I figured, I played football, that was one thing I could easily relate to. Girls, Military, Video Games, and the over-watering of cards back in the 90's kind of killed my remaining love for cards and collecting.

I do remember Superman's Death, and was intrigued! I wanted to read about his death, wanted to learn about it, but I was young and impressionable. Dad already coughed up some money to get me started on cards, he wasn't going to open THAT can of worms too.

Military. I was good at that. I could teach, I could yell. They said, go become a Basic Military Training Instructor (Air Force Basic Training), so I did. Met thousands of kids, taught them all, made an impression. Some maintained contact (after their careers started and FB became a thing).

Emerald City Comic Con (Seattle), been going for the last 4 or 5 years, absolutely love it! Started with a few Crossed, didn't last. Year after year I went, mainly for the art and the local comic book talent (still love the Scottish Ninjas). One of the guys I put through Basic Training that I still talk to asked me to hook him up with a few things this year, especially if they were free. Sure I said, If it's for free, it's for me, I'll check it out. He tells me that Valiant was hot back in the 90's, but fell apart in the early 2000's. Started making a huge come back around 2012 in a big way and he was starting to really get back into them. Said he would send me some of his old comics my way as part of a trade. OK, sounds like fun, I'll swing by and take a look. I spent some time studying the history of Valiant (who is this Dinesh character? Acclaim? Movies?).

First stop Thursday AM was at the Valiant table (ECCC is 4 kick *SQUEE* days!), best to see what I can get for free early. Started talking to this short guy with a "Nerd Boss" baseball cap on, and joked that I thought his hat was funny. "Yea, I'm the boss of all these nerds here, even if they don't want me to be (or something of that sort)". OK, I'm still not sure who this guy is at first. I tell him about the guy I put through the military, how he is a big fan, I was curious. I bought a few books (5 for $15 was a good deal), then it donned on me. *SQUEE*, that's the CEO! This whole time, I just thought this guy was the head guy for this table, not the FREAKIN CEO! Honestly, I thought he looked way to young to be a CEO.

So, how is Dinesh evil? Simple, he gave me free crap! Wrath of the Eternal Warrior Gold was the first hook he sank into me. But before he decided to hand it to me, he said "Hey Robert, sign these real quick please" (yea Robert Venditti). He then turned to me and said "This one is for you, and this one is for your friend, tell him I said thank you." Was it a lack of coffee? Second hand smoke (it's legal here)? It didn't click in at all. Many interactions later, purchased T-shirt, Panels, Faith, A&A, Imperium, and Wrath Gold #1's and I was utterly hooked! Set up a pull list a mile long that next Wednesday! Damn you Dinesh (because I know he will read this)! My whiskey allowance (two bottles a month) has now become my comic allowance, and I love (and miss) whiskey!!

Seriously, if a company's CEO spends as much time as Dinesh spent with me, well they have earned my loyalty. Mad Love, Much Respect!
